In April 2010, 12 young adult cancer survivors from across North America will converge in Lima, Peru to embark on an incredible expedition, symbolic of their journey through cancer. Their goal: to support and inspire eachother’s ongoing healing while raising awareness for the unique challenges young adults face with a cancer diagnosis. This 9-day expedition to mystical Peru will be a challenge worthy of their courageous spirit. These warriors will face the difficult mountain and jungle terrains of the Andes to summit at the Lost City of the Incas, Machu Picchu.
